Jet.AI Inc. reported a first-quarter 2026 loss per share of -$6.68, significantly missing the consensus estimate of -$4.08. The negative surprise of approximately 63.7% underscores continued operational headwinds. The company did not disclose quarterly revenue, and the stock saw no immediate price change in the after-hours session.

Management attributed the wider-than-expected loss to increased research and development spending and higher general administrative costs associated with scaling the company’s proprietary AI platform. During the earnings call, executives highlighted progress in deploying their next-generation aviation intelligence software, though they acknowledged that monetization efforts are still in early stages. Operating margins remained under pressure as the company invested heavily in talent acquisition and cloud infrastructure. Segment performance was not broken out in detail, but management noted that customer acquisition costs rose during the quarter as they targeted enterprise contracts. The reported EPS of -$6.68 reflects a non-cash charge related to stock-based compensation and warrant revaluation, further weighing on the bottom line. Without a disclosed revenue figure, analysts have limited visibility into top-line trends, making it difficult to assess unit economics at this stage. Jet.AI Inc. The company expects to continue investing in its core AI models and may explore strategic partnerships to accelerate commercial adoption. No formal revenue guidance was offered, but executives anticipate that several pilot programs could convert into recurring contracts by the second half of the year. However, they flagged risks tied to prolonged sales cycles and potential delays in regulatory approvals for AI applications in aviation. The company’s cash position remains adequate for current operations, but management emphasized that further dilution or debt financing might be necessary if revenue growth does not materialize as planned. The market’s muted response—a 0.0% change following the release—suggests that the earnings miss was largely anticipated, or that investors are waiting for clearer catalysts. Several sell-side analysts covering the stock have revised their near-term estimates downward, citing the lack of revenue disclosure and the deeper-than-expected loss. Optimists point to Jet.AI’s unique positioning in the AI-driven aviation niche, but cautious voices argue that the company must demonstrate revenue traction before the stock can gain momentum. Key items to watch in the coming quarters include any revenue disclosures, margin improvements, and updates on the company’s capital-raising activities. Without a clearer path to profitability, JTAI may continue to face valuation skepticism. The next quarterly report will be critical for gauging whether the current investments are beginning to yield measurable results.
